are polar hrm interchangable?

I had a polar hrm, not sure of the model. I moved recently and seem to have lost the watch part in the move. I still have the chest strap. Does anyone know if I get a different watch part, can I link it up with the strap part? Or do I need to get a whole new set?

I have several Polar Watches and HRM and my experience has been good with them being inter-changeable. Sometimes there is a lag period of a few mins while it finds my heart rate, but I almost always have had them work. So you should be fine unless your new watch is a big upgrade from your old one and it uses some new technology for the chest strap. I have several older model chest straps that wont work with newer versions. I believe most watches if you have to buy a new one though comes with a free strap?? Hope this helps.0
